Ticket: Staging env misconfigured for Siftgate bloom filter

The bloom layer in front of the Pellet KV store is rejecting all lookups in staging because the env file was copied from the dev template without credentials. False-positive tuning values are fine; only the auth line is missing. To unblock the weekly demo, the Pellet admission secret must be set on the following line.

env line for yaguf-fajop: LEDGER_TOKEN13=fb08984397349

Handover: Paylune retry path. Idempotency keys are generated client-side, scoped per merchant, stored in Vaultbed with a 24h TTL. Replays return the cached response; mismatched payloads get rejected with a conflict error. Key derivation uses the request hash, not order ID. Threat notes and validation rules are on the internal page here.

wiki page, tahaf-tajog: https://jira.ordindyn.corp/pipeline

Welcome aboard. The Fleetline dispatcher assigns drivers using a weighted score: proximity, shift fatigue, and vehicle class match. The fatigue term is the fragile part — it decays hourly and resets at shift boundaries, so test any change against the Calder Bay replay suite before merging. Marit tuned the weights last quarter after the overassignment incident, and they've been stable since. Don't adjust them by intuition; rerun the replay harness. For reference, the production service runs with these settings.

service settings:
novath:
  pin: 1396
  tenant: pelys
  seal: seal_ccc035e1
  metrics_host: metrics.novath.qorvelworks.test
  standby_team: fraeth
  escalation: drueth-zorok
  nonce: 61d508

**Checklist item 7: Log compaction.** Before tagging the Quillstream release, confirm the compaction worker drains the `orders-replay` topic without dropping tombstones. Run the compaction dry-run against staging, diff the segment counts, and verify retention math matches the config Henrik updated last sprint. Any mismatch over 2% blocks the release. Once the dry-run passes, record the candidate build token directly beneath this item.

build token for yajof-bajof: htk31_506ff1188f74596b5bb2eec94edc43c